From 26cd05e9619dfe251185303401c3edd9c680db22 Mon Sep 17 00:00:00 2001 From: unkin-agent Date: Sun, 30 Aug 2026 00:50:35 +1000 Subject: [PATCH] Make the Vault gitea creds path selectable agentpr always read gitea/creds/unkin-agent from a bare const, so a service like repospawner could not run it as its own Gitea identity. - Replace the GiteaCredsPath const with a function: GITEA_CREDS_PATH when set, otherwise gitea/creds/. Unset env still resolves to gitea/creds/unkin-agent, so existing callers are unchanged. - Thread the creds path through fetchGiteaToken/readGiteaCreds instead of reading a package-level const, and report it in the error messages. - Make agentpr's help text login-agnostic and document both variables. --- AGENTS.md | 17 ++-- README.md | 23 ++--- cmd/agentpr/main.go | 14 +-- internal/agent/client_test.go | 13 +-- internal/agent/token.go | 38 ++++++--- internal/agent/token_test.go | 155 ++++++++++++++++++++++++++++++++++ internal/agent/vault.go | 15 ++-- 7 files changed, 227 insertions(+), 48 deletions(-) create mode 100644 internal/agent/token_test.go diff --git a/AGENTS.md b/AGENTS.md index e30517d..b500548 100644 --- a/AGENTS.md +++ b/AGENTS.md @@ -3,8 +3,10 @@ ## Project Overview This repo ships several Gitea-automation CLIs in one RPM (`agent-tools`).
